What they do

A Hospital Security Officer provides security for property at hospitals. Monitors entrances and patrols buildings, watches for intruders or vandals; reports building maintenance problems; deals with customers or visitors that create a disturbance in the building.

Private Security Professionals Tri-Star Solutions - 5.0 Eugene, OR Job Details Temporary | Full-time | Contract $25 - $30 an hour 1 day ago Benefits Professional development assistance Flexible schedule Qualifications Report preparation Stress management Military Surveillance Security threat response protocols Patience Full Job Description Position Overview Tri-Star Solutions seeks highly capable security professionals to execute high-level protective operations for executive clients, corporate environments, private events, and elevated-risk assignments. This role requires disciplined personnel who can operate with discretion, situational control, and sound judgment while reporting directly to on-site management, assigned command staff, and Tri-Star Solutions Security Professional Leads. Core Responsibilities Provide close protection, protective presence, and operational support for executives, clients, staff, and designated assets during assignments. Conduct advance planning, threat recognition, route review, venue assessment, and vulnerability identification prior to and during operations. Maintain a professional security posture during executive movements, client engagements, corporate functions, and event operations. Observe, detect, and immediately report suspicious behavior, operational deficiencies, safety concerns, and emerging threats through the established chain of command. Support incident response, emergency movement, de-escalation, and protective repositioning as directed by management or Tri-Star Solutions Security Professional Leads. Complete accurate documentation including incident reports, activity logs, shift notes, and operational observations in accordance with company standards. Operate and maintain communications equipment, protective gear, assigned vehicles, and other mission-essential tools in a constant state of readiness. Reporting Structure This position operates under a strict professional command structure and is expected to function with full respect for operational leadership and assignment control. Personnel in this role report to on-site management, designated client-facing supervisors when applicable, and Tri-Star Solutions Security Professional Leads for direction, escalation, accountability, and mission execution. Qualifications Prior experience in executive protection, private security, event security, corporate security, military, law enforcement, or comparable high-responsibility environments is strongly preferred. Strong situational awareness, discretion, communication discipline, and the ability to remain calm under pressure are essential to the role. Ability to work long hours, changing schedules, nights, weekends, travel assignments, and high-visibility environments is expected. Defensive mindset, professional appearance, report-writing ability, and willingness to follow mission direction without deviation are required. Applicable licensing, permits, certifications, and lawful work authorization must be maintained as required by assignment and jurisdiction.
